Simple Summer Nail Care Tips (Because Chips Are Not Cute)
You can have the prettiest nails ever, but if they’re chipped by day two? Tragic.
First things first—always use a base coat. I know, I know, it feels optional. It’s not. It keeps your polish smooth and prevents staining (especially with brighter summer colors).
Second, hydration is everything. Keep a cuticle oil in your bag and use it like lip balm. Dry cuticles instantly ruin the vibe, no matter how cute your color is.
And please—don’t skip the top coat. A high-shine, long-wear top coat locks everything in and gives that glossy, fresh-from-the-salon finish. Reapply every few days if you want your nails to last.

How do I make my summer manicure last longer?
Start with clean nails, use a base coat, and seal everything with a durable top coat. Reapply the top coat every few days and keep your cuticles hydrated. Also—try not to use your nails as tools (we’ve all been guilty).
